** Maintenance Group Lead, Coating & Bonding
** to oversee all aspects of Coatings, including Thinfilm / Electrocoat systems, conveyance, sealer systems (robotic and manual), robotic bonding cells, breakdown management, and root-cause analysis (RCA) – from urgent repairs to capital projects.  This role sets the standard for safety, efficiency, and reliability across equipment, machinery, and facility systems.

The Maintenance Group Leader will lead a skilled maintenance team to support production uptime and equipment reliability, while championing a culture of safety, continuous improvement, and technical excellence.  They will partner with Production, Engineering, and Plant Leadership to minimize downtime and drive performance.

**** WHAT YOU GET TO DO
*** Supervise, coach, and develop a team of maintenance technicians, setting expectations and ensuring adherence to safe work practices (LOTO, PPE, SOPs).
* Plan, execute, and continuously improve preventive and predictive maintenance programs.
* Troubleshoot and repair systems, including mechanical, hydraulic, pneumatic, electrical, PLCs, robotics, and vision systems.
* Coordinate and oversee contractors, vendors, and capital project work to ensure compliance with safety, quality, and performance standards.
* Partner with Production to minimize downtime, lead root-cause analysis (RCA), and implement corrective actions.
* Manage spare parts inventory, reorder points, and cost controls; recommend critical spares.
* Lead installations, rigging, alignments, rebuilds, and equipment upgrades.
* Review blueprints, schematics, and technical drawings to support repair and project work.
* Ensure accurate documentation of work orders, PMs, and downtime events; report on KPIs (MTBF, MTTR, backlog).
* Oversee vendor quotes, scheduling, quality checks, and contractor safety compliance.
* Drive housekeeping, 5S standards, and safety culture across the shop.
* Advise leadership on long-term equipment reliability, capital investment, and facility upgrades.
** WHAT YOU BRING TO THE TEAM
***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(or equivalent discipline) is preferred.
* 3+ years of directly relevant experience in maintenance / manufacturing with Bachelor’s degree, OR 7+ years of directly relevant experience in maintenance / manufacturing without Bachelor’s degree.
* 2+ years of experience in a supervisory or lead role in maintenance / manufacturing.
* Hands-on proficiency with conveyors, bearings, seals, shafts, hydraulics, pneumatics, and pipe fitting.
* Skilled in welding / fabrication, machining, rigging, cranes / hoists, and forklifts.
* Proficiency in PLC systems, robotics, and electrical troubleshooting.
* Ability to read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and technical manuals.
* Knowledge of TPM, Lean Manufacturing, Kaizen, and CI practices with measurable impact on MTBF / MTTR.
* Experienced in vendor management, budgeting, and capital improvement projects.
* Proficiency with Microsoft Office (Outlook, Teams,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and CMMS systems.
* Safety-focused, results-driven, and committed to operational excellence
* Proven ability to coach, schedule, and manage multi-skilled trades teams.
*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ills.
* Certifications in maintenance, safety, Six Sigma, or leadership development / training are preferred.
* Certifications in fork truck, man lift, etc. are preferred.
